The weight of paper is determined in grams per square meter (GSM) or pounds (lb). The greater the GSM or poundage, the thicker and more substantial the paper. Here are some typical weight categories:

Tips for Storing and Handling Printing Paper
Correct storage and handling of printing paper can maintain its quality. Consider the following ideas:

Store in a Climate-Controlled Environment: Extreme humidity or dryness can warp paper. Keep it in a cool, dry area.

Avoid Direct Sunlight: Prolonged exposure to sunlight can cause fading and staining.

Prevent Stacking Too High: Excess weight can trigger bending or deforming. Store in flat stacks when possible.

Handle with Clean Hands: Oil and dirt from hands can impact the paper quality. Always handle with care.

4. What weight of paper should I utilize for service cards?
For company cards, heavyweight paper (around 250-300 GSM) is recommended to make sure resilience and an expert feel.
